2017 Vermont Mentoring Symposium
Organized by Mobius and the Program Leadership Council, the 2017 Mentoring Symposium was an opportunity for mentoring program professionals throughout Vermont to come together to collaborate, share, and learn from one another. The symposium featured workshops and networking, a mentor/mentee panel facilitated by Rebecca Holcombe, Vermont Secretary of Education, a guest appearance from Congressman Peter Welch, and speeches by Katarina Lisaius from the office of Senator Bernie Sanders, Diane Derby from the office of Senator Patrick Leahy, and closing remarks by DCF Commissioner Ken Schatz.
